His Role on the International Stage: A Whirlwind of Talent

Tactically, Vini is a dream. He typically occupies the left wing, a position where his blistering pace, dizzying dribbling, and incredible agility can wreak absolute havoc. He's not just a runner; he's a creator, a goal-scorer, a defender’s nightmare. His ability to cut inside or drive to the byline keeps opponents guessing, creating space for others. He links up beautifully with Neymar, when he's around, or Rodrygo and Raphinha, forming a front line that's as fluid as it is formidable. He’s got that street football flair, that 'ginga' that makes Brazilian football so captivating to watch. It's not just about winning; it's about winning with style, with joy, with that distinct Brazilian swagger. And Vini embodies that. He plays with a smile, but also with a ruthless efficiency that has elevated his game to another level.Beyond the tactics, his role is also deeply emotional. Navigating the Minefield: Pressure, Expectations, and the Spotlight

Being a star for Brazil is never easy. It comes with an almost unbearable burden of expectation. Every touch is scrutinized, every missed pass amplified. There are comparisons, always comparisons: Is he the next Neymar? Can he fill Ronaldo’s shoes? It’s a relentless spotlight. And then there's the ugly side – the racism he has endured, especially in Spain, but which sadly can follow players anywhere. Yet, Vini has faced it head-on, not just as a victim, but as an advocate, speaking out and using his platform for change. This resilience, this inner strength, is just as crucial as his on-field brilliance. It shows a maturity beyond his years and only solidifies his standing as a leader, not just in football, but in a broader sense. He's learning to cope with the immense pressure, to let his football do the talking, and frankly, it's screaming success.
